Friday, April 23. Pattern: Felted Buttonhole Bag. Yarn used: Wendy Allegra KP Wool of the Andes Bulky. Size: 18" x 7". Inside: Lining with a zipped compartment and few other compartments for hand phone, keys, cosmetics and etc. Links to this post. Thursday, April 22. Endless Knitted Cardi Shawl. Pattern: Endless Knitted Cardi. Shawl by Jennifer Hansen,. Published in Stitch Diva Studios. Yarn used: Online Sandy, Blue. Needle used: 3.5mm. This is a very comfortable and flexible cardi.
